在竞争激烈的市场环境中,企业要想脱颖而出,就必须深入了解消费者的需求和行为。市场调研作为获取这些信息的重要手段,其价值不言而喻。本文将揭秘如何通过数据读懂消费者心,为企业决策提供有力支持。
数据收集:多渠道、全方位
市场调研的第一步是数据收集。企业可以通过以下渠道获取消费者数据:
1. 问卷调查
问卷调查是一种常用的数据收集方法,通过设计合理的问题,可以收集到大量关于消费者偏好、购买行为等方面的信息。
# 示例:设计一个简单的问卷调查
questions = [
"您最喜欢的手机品牌是?",
"您购买手机时最关注的因素是什么?",
"您通常在什么场合使用手机?"
]
# 收集用户回答
answers = {}
for q in questions:
answer = input(q)
answers[q] = answer
print(answers)
2. 网络监测
通过分析社交媒体、论坛、博客等网络平台上的数据,可以了解消费者对某一产品或品牌的看法和评价。
# 示例:使用Python的Tweepy库分析Twitter数据
import tweepy
# 获取Twitter API密钥
consumer_key = 'YOUR_CONSUMER_KEY'
consumer_secret = 'YOUR_CONSUMER_SECRET'
access_token = 'YOUR_ACCESS_TOKEN'
access_token_secret = 'YOUR_ACCESS_TOKEN_SECRET'
# 初始化Tweepy API
auth = tweepy.OAuthHandler(consumer_key, consumer_secret)
auth.set_access_token(access_token, access_token_secret)
api = tweepy.API(auth)
# 搜索关键词
search_results = api.search('iPhone', count=100)
# 分析搜索结果
for result in search_results:
print(result.text)
3. 实地调研
实地调研包括访谈、观察等,可以直接了解消费者的行为和需求。
# 示例:设计一个访谈问卷
interview_questions = [
"您为什么选择购买这款产品?",
"您在使用过程中遇到过什么问题?",
"您对这款产品的改进建议是什么?"
]
# 进行访谈
for q in interview_questions:
print(q)
answer = input()
print(f"您的回答是:{answer}")
数据分析:挖掘消费者心理
收集到数据后,企业需要对这些数据进行深入分析,挖掘消费者心理。
1. 统计分析
通过统计分析,可以了解消费者群体的基本特征、购买行为等。
import pandas as pd
# 示例:使用Pandas库进行数据分析
data = {
'年龄': [25, 30, 35, 40],
'性别': ['男', '女', '男', '女'],
'收入': [5000, 6000, 7000, 8000],
'购买频率': [1, 2, 3, 4]
}
df = pd.DataFrame(data)
# 统计分析
print(df.describe())
2. 心理分析
通过心理学理论,分析消费者的购买动机、购买行为等。
# 示例:使用Python进行心理分析
from textblob import TextBlob
# 分析消费者评论
comments = ["这款手机太棒了!", "我再也不想用安卓手机了!"]
for comment in comments:
sentiment = TextBlob(comment).sentiment
print(f"评论:{comment}\n情感极性:{sentiment.polarity}\n情感强度:{sentiment.subjectivity}")
应用数据:助力企业决策
通过对消费者数据的分析,企业可以更好地了解市场需求,为产品研发、营销策略等提供有力支持。
1. 产品研发
根据消费者需求,优化产品功能和设计,提高产品竞争力。
# 示例:根据数据分析结果,优化产品功能
new_features = {
'功能一': '改进描述',
'功能二': '改进描述'
}
print("新产品功能:")
for feature, description in new_features.items():
print(f"{feature}: {description}")
2. 营销策略
针对不同消费者群体,制定有针对性的营销策略,提高市场占有率。
# 示例:根据数据分析结果,制定营销策略
marketing_strategies = {
'目标群体一': '策略描述',
'目标群体二': '策略描述'
}
print("营销策略:")
for group, strategy in marketing_strategies.items():
print(f"{group}: {strategy}")
通过以上方法,企业可以更好地了解消费者心理,从而制定出更有效的决策,提升市场竞争力。
